Took a quick trip after school yesterday afternoon. Fished bay on upper Coosa. Caught 6 keeper males not in spawning colors. No females. Surface temp. 61 degrees but Im sure it is really dropping at night. Not Marking a lot of bait yet. It was a little better than last week but not real good. Hope it gets better. This is my go to spot when fish move up so I hope they do something soon. High water and weather may mess them up. They are catching some fish on the lower end in the deeper creeks but I don't have time to go down there in afternoon.
